Specialized Trailers for Moving Boring & Drilling Machines

Boring & Drilling Machines usually require more than a standard flatbed. Depending on height, length, and weight, our fleet may use RGNs, lowboys, step decks, double drops, or multi-axle trailers. The right choice depends on whether the machine sits low and wide, tall and compact, or long with uneven weight distribution. For oversized load trucking, the trailer must support secure tie-down points and allow proper deck height for bridge and overhead clearance. Flatbed trucking companies often handle general freight, but heavy machinery transportation needs a more exact setup. A lowboy can reduce overall height, while an RGN helps with equipment that needs a recessed deck. Multi-axle trailers spread weight for heavier units and help with axle compliance on Texas roads. Heavy Haul Transporting reviews the load dimensions before dispatch so the trailer matches the machine, not the other way around. That is how heavy haul trucking keeps drilling equipment stable from the port exit to the final destination.

Permits, Escorts, and Texas Route Planning

Texas oversize moves require careful planning, especially when a machine leaves Port Freeport, TX and heads toward Houston, San Antonio, Dallas, or inland industrial sites. We look at route surveys, bridge clearances, lane widths, turning space, and weight restrictions before the truck rolls. Oversize permits may call for escort vehicles, signage, lighting, and time-of-day restrictions depending on dimensions and route conditions. Road access often uses SH 36, FM 1495, SH 288, and connections toward I-10, I-45, and US-59, but every move still needs a load-specific review. A route that works for one machine may fail for another because of height, overhang, or axle spread. Heavy Haulers coordinate with permit rules, local restrictions, and utility clearances so the move stays legal from start to finish.
